High Tech Pharm Co. Ltd (106190) — Working Capital to Net Assets Ratio
High Tech Pharm Co. Ltd (106190) has a Working Capital to Net Assets ratio of 42.7% as of September 2025. Working capital of ₩54.21 Billion (current assets of ₩66.11 Billion minus current liabilities of ₩11.90 Billion) is measured against net assets of ₩126.99 Billion. Annual Working Capital to Net Assets for High Tech Pharm Co. Ltd (2014–2024)
The table below presents the year-by-year Working Capital to Net Assets ratio for High Tech Pharm Co. Ltd from 2014 to 2024, covering 11 annual filings. | Year | WC/NA Ratio | Working Capital (KRW) | Net Assets | Current Assets | Current Liabilities | Change (pp)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| 37.8% | ₩45.29 Billion | ₩119.74 Billion | ₩64.23 Billion | ₩18.95 Billion | ▲ +6.2 pp |
| 2023 | 31.6% | ₩33.79 Billion | ₩106.99 Billion | ₩56.57 Billion | ₩22.79 Billion | ▲ +11.3 pp |
| 2022 | 20.3% | ₩20.30 Billion | ₩99.94 Billion | ₩52.04 Billion | ₩31.74 Billion | ▲ +1.4 pp |
| 2021 | 18.9% | ₩17.79 Billion | ₩93.88 Billion | ₩40.49 Billion | ₩22.70 Billion | ▲ +4.7 pp |
| 2020 | 14.2% | ₩13.54 Billion | ₩95.14 Billion | ₩40.48 Billion | ₩26.93 Billion | ▲ +0.6 pp |
| 2019 | 13.7% | ₩13.47 Billion | ₩98.58 Billion | ₩39.02 Billion | ₩25.55 Billion | ▲ +5.3 pp |
| 2018 | 8.4% | ₩8.65 Billion | ₩103.35 Billion | ₩33.66 Billion | ₩25.01 Billion | ▼ -6.2 pp |
| 2017 | 14.6% | ₩14.89 Billion | ₩102.19 Billion | ₩31.16 Billion | ₩16.28 Billion | ▼ -10.7 pp |
| 2016 | 25.3% | ₩25.60 Billion | ₩101.18 Billion | ₩41.49 Billion | ₩15.89 Billion | ▼ -20.2 pp |
| 2015 | 45.5% | ₩44.24 Billion | ₩97.20 Billion | ₩57.56 Billion | ₩13.32 Billion | ▼ -17.2 pp |
| 2014 | 62.7% | ₩57.75 Billion | ₩92.06 Billion | ₩70.98 Billion | ₩13.23 Billion | — |
